Dry has one more shot at Beijing place

-

MARK Dry will have one more crack at sealing his spot at the world championsh­ips in Loughborou­gh today – two months after smashing the Scottish record at the same venue.

The UK silver medallist needs to throw the qualifying standard of 74 metres one more time to automatica­lly book his place in Beijing.

“I really want to go,” he said. “I know I can throw even longer and if I do that, then they’ll have to pick me.”
